David Aebischer (sort of) back in NHL with Winnipeg Jets

David Aebischer's last NHL game was an Oct. 10 loss at the Columbus Blue Jackets while he was a member of the Phoenix Coyotes. As in October 10, 2007. Since 2007, he's been a goaltender for HC Lugano of the Swiss Nationalliga A. Ex-NHL G Aebischer to attend Jets' training camp

Former NHL goaltender David Aebischer is expected to attend the Winnipeg Jets' training camp on a tryout. Aebischer, who has played with HC Lugano of the Swiss Nationalliga A for the last four years, will vie for a roster spot with Ondrej Pavelec and Chris Mason.
